Introduction: The Gateway to the Indian Stock Market
The Indian stock market, comprising the National Stock Exchange (NSE) and the Bombay Stock Exchange (BSE), presents a wealth of opportunities for investors to grow their wealth. Whether you’re a seasoned trader or a newbie eager to begin your investment journey, having a Demat account is paramount. A Demat account, short for Dematerialized Account, is like a digital locker where your shares and securities are held in electronic form. This has replaced the older practice of holding physical share certificates, making trading and investing significantly more efficient and accessible.
Why is a Demat Account Essential?
Before diving into how to open a Demat account, let’s understand why it’s so crucial. Here are some key benefits:
- Mandatory for Trading: SEBI (Securities and Exchange Board of India), the regulatory body governing the Indian stock market, mandates a Demat account for trading in equities, bonds, and other securities.
- Safe and Secure: Holding shares in a dematerialized form eliminates the risk of loss, theft, or damage associated with physical certificates.
- Easy Transfer of Shares: Transferring shares is seamless and quick. Transactions are executed electronically, minimizing paperwork and delays.
- Access to IPOs and Mutual Funds: A Demat account allows you to apply for Initial Public Offerings (IPOs) and invest in mutual funds with ease.
- Convenient Corporate Actions: Receive dividends, bonus shares, and rights issues directly into your Demat account.

Understanding the Instant Demat Account Opening Process
The process of opening an instant Demat account is streamlined and typically involves the following steps:
Step 1: Choosing a Depository Participant (DP)
A Depository Participant (DP) is an agent of the Depository (NSDL or CDSL) through which you can access Demat services. Selecting the right DP is crucial. Consider factors such as brokerage fees, platform usability, research support, and customer service before making your choice. Prominent DPs include brokerage firms like Zerodha, Upstox, Angel One, and banks like HDFC Bank and ICICI Bank.
Step 2: Online Application
Visit the DP’s website or mobile app and initiate the account opening process. You’ll typically need to provide your personal details, including your name, address, date of birth, PAN (Permanent Account Number), and bank account details.
Step 3: KYC Verification
KYC (Know Your Customer) verification is a mandatory regulatory requirement. For instant account opening, the KYC process is usually completed online via e-KYC. This involves uploading scanned copies of your required documents and undergoing an online verification process.
Step 4: Document Submission
You’ll need to submit scanned copies of the following documents:
- PAN Card: Mandatory for all investors.
- Aadhaar Card: Used for address verification and e-KYC.
- Proof of Address: Can be your Aadhaar card, passport, driving license, or utility bill.
- Proof of Identity: PAN card serves as proof of identity.
- Bank Account Proof: Canceled cheque or bank statement.
- Passport size photograph: A recent passport size photograph.
Step 5: In-Person Verification (IPV)
Previously, In-Person Verification (IPV) was a mandatory part of the KYC process. However, SEBI has allowed online IPV through video calls, making the account opening process even more convenient. The DP will conduct a video call to verify your identity.
Step 6: Account Activation
Once your documents are verified and the IPV is completed, your Demat account will be activated. You’ll receive your account number and other login details, enabling you to start trading and investing.

Choosing the Right DP for Your Needs
Selecting the right DP is critical for a smooth and rewarding investment experience. Here are some factors to consider:
- Brokerage Charges: Compare brokerage rates across different DPs. Some offer flat fee models, while others charge a percentage of the transaction value.
- Account Maintenance Charges: Inquire about annual maintenance charges (AMC) and other hidden fees.
- Trading Platform: Evaluate the usability and features of the DP’s trading platform. Look for user-friendly interfaces, real-time data, and advanced charting tools.
- Research and Advisory Services: If you’re a beginner, consider DPs that offer research reports, investment recommendations, and educational resources.
- Customer Support: Ensure the DP provides reliable customer support through phone, email, or chat.
- Reputation and Reliability: Choose a DP with a good track record and a strong reputation in the market.
Investing Options After Opening Your Demat Account
Once your Demat account is active, you can explore a wide range of investment options:
- Equity Shares: Invest in stocks of publicly listed companies on the NSE and BSE.
- Mutual Funds: Invest in diversified portfolios of stocks, bonds, or other assets managed by professional fund managers. You can invest through SIPs (Systematic Investment Plans) for disciplined, regular investing.
- Initial Public Offerings (IPOs): Apply for shares of companies launching their IPOs.
- Exchange Traded Funds (ETFs): Invest in baskets of securities that track a specific index or sector.
- Bonds and Debentures: Invest in fixed-income securities issued by government entities or corporations.
- Derivatives: Trade in futures and options contracts based on underlying assets. (Requires a higher risk appetite and understanding).
Tax Benefits of Investing Through a Demat Account
Investing through a Demat account can also offer tax benefits. Investments in certain instruments, such as Equity Linked Savings Schemes (ELSS) mutual funds, qualify for tax deductions under Section 80C of the Income Tax Act. Other investments, such as the Public Provident Fund (PPF) and the National Pension System (NPS), also offer tax benefits.
